Description:

This is the name given to the Moon in most of the Old World. When this name is used it is usually associated with this deity being a female deity (such as in Analand) and the sister of Glantanka. Like her sister the Sun, Lunara is depicted with glowing eyes with no pupils and she radiates light.

In those lands where the Moon is female the relationship between the Moon and Sindla and her children is not apparent.
